**Ticket #2214 — Config drift on Spanview diff workers**

Heads up, future folks: the large-file diff viewer (Spanview) is behaving differently across the three worker pools. Chunking thresholds and the memory cap got hand-edited on pool-b during the Velthorp outage and never synced back. Result: 200MB+ files render fine on one pool and time out on the others. Please reconcile from the repo, not from a live box. For reference, the intended baseline config is the following.

service settings:
druael:
  log_level: error
  metrics_host: metrics.druael.tolvaqlabs.internal
  pool_size: 16

MEMO — Spare Parts Run, Copperridge Station

To the drivers' coordinator: the pump spares for Copperridge finally arrived from Hartwell Components, so we need them on tomorrow's run before the site crew loses another day. Two crates, both tagged and weighed, waiting at Bay 2. Bristlefen Haulage is covering the leg since our van is in the shop. When their driver collects, pass on this instruction word for word:

dispatch memo: the quenax olidor courier leaves the lamvan aldath keliel ledger at gate 2085 under passcode 005795

**Leadership Review Briefing — Retiring the Pondhopper Line**

Quick version for department heads: Pondhopper has been a great little earner for Kettleby Goods, but the numbers no longer stack up. Component costs rose 30% this year and our supplier in Marwick Vale is exiting the market. Plan: final production run in autumn, warranty cover honoured for two years, staff redeployed to the Skylark team. Questions welcome at Thursday's session. The confidential context appears just below this note.

board note of kagep-yahig: Only 9 of the 120 pilot accounts renewed Quenix, so a churn review is set for April 1.

FACILITIES TICKET — Oakhurst Plaza

Summary: Goods lift (Lift D) reserved for furniture deliveries to Level 6, Thursday 09:00–13:00. Reception staff: please direct the delivery crew from Marsh & Tilby Removals to the rear corridor and do not allow general staff use of Lift D during the reservation window. Passenger lifts A–C remain available as normal. The crew will need access through the rear corridor door, which stays locked at all times. Give the crew lead the door code printed below.

turnstile pass: bdg-NG-3